T-cell engagers mediate deep cell depletion beyond autoimmunity
Johanna T Kurzhagen1, William Laqua1, Mario Schiffer1
1Department of Medicine 4, Nephrology and Hypertension, University Hospital Erlangen, Friedrich-Alexander-Universität (FAU) Erlangen-Nürnberg, Erlangen, Germany; Deutsches Zentrum Immuntherapie, University Hospital Erlangen, Friedrich-Alexander-Universität (FAU) Erlangen-Nürnberg, Erlangen, Germany.
Deep B-cell and plasma cell depletion is rapidly reshaping the therapeutic landscape. Initially developed for hematologic malignancies, T cell-redirecting therapies (chimeric antigen receptor T cells and T-cell engagers) are now demonstrating profound efficacy in autoimmune diseases. The first successful application of a B-cell maturation antigen-targeting T-cell engager to achieve human leukocyte antigen desensitization in a highly sensitized kidney transplant candidate marks yet another critical milestone: This success signals a "spillover" of deep cell depletion into nonmalignant, nonautoimmune indications and paves the way for novel strategies in transplantation tolerance, severe allergic diseases, and beyond.
